SolidWorks 无法启动通常由许可证服务异常、系统配置问题或软件组件损坏导致,可按以下维度排查解决 。
许可证服务问题
重启 FlexNet 服务:在服务管理器中找到"SolidWorks Flexnet Server",启动类型设为自动并重启服务 。
重置许可服务:以管理员身份运行 server_remove 和 server_install 脚本重新安装许可服务 。
检查电脑名称:确保计算机名为纯英文,不含中文或特殊符号 。
系统配置问题
环境变量设置:检查 TEMP 环境变量是否正确设置为临时目录 。
关闭 UTF-8 设置:在区域设置中取消"使用 Unicode UTF-8 进行全球语言支持"选项 。
兼容性模式:检查程序属性中的兼容性设置,禁用错误的兼容模式 。
软件组件与权限
VBA 组件修复:删除 C:\Program Files\Common Files\Microsoft Shared\VBA 文件夹,重新安装 SolidWorks 安装包中的 VBA 组件 。
权限设置:右键程序属性,在安全选项卡中设置完全控制权限,或以管理员身份运行 。
系统文件修复:使用 sfc /scannow 命令修复受损的系统文件 。
如上述方法无效,建议联系 SolidWorks 官方技术支持 。
武汉格发信息技术有限公司 | 许可分析,许可优化,许可管理,许可授权,软件授权